Geometric Model, L. Brill No. 6. Carton Ser. No. 2, Ellipsoid

Description:

This yellow paper model of an ellipsoid is stored flat. It consists of fourteen circular discs intersecting fourteen other circular discs. It is stored in a gray paper envelope with 1985.0112.07. The entire Carton series is in a brown paper box. Unfolded, it is a model of an ellipsoid.

A mark stamped on the model reads: Verlag von L. Brill in Darmstadt.
